Choosing a Color Palette

Selecting a color palette is crucial in achieving the perfect boho bedding look. You want to choose colors that resonate with you while still allowing for the mixing of patterns. Here are some tips:

  • Start with a base color: Choose one or two neutral shades like beige or white.
  • Add pops of color: Incorporate warm tones such as oranges, reds, and yellows, or cool tones like teal and purple.
  • Limit your palette: Stick to three to five colors to keep everything feeling harmonized.

This careful selection will serve as a foundation when mixing patterns.

Layering Patterns

Layering is essential in achieving that effortlessly boho look. Here’s how you can effectively layer patterns:

  • Start with a patterned duvet cover: This will be the focal point of your bedding.
  • Add in a patterned sheet: Choose something that either contrasts or complements your duvet.
  • Incorporate throw pillows: Use different patterned pillowcases in various sizes to create a layered effect.

Remember, the key is to ensure that all patterns have at least one color in common from your chosen palette.

Creating Balance

Mixing patterns and textures can lead to chaos if not balanced correctly. Here are some tips to achieve balance in your boho bedding:

  • Use solid colors: Incorporate solid-colored items to avoid overwhelming the eye.
  • Vary the scale of patterns: Pair larger patterns with smaller ones to create visual diversity.
  • Keep one dominant pattern: This will help establish a focal point in your bedding.

What types of patterns work well together in boho bedding?

In boho bedding, floral, geometric, and tribal patterns mix beautifully. Floral designs bring a natural, organic feel, while geometric patterns add structure. Tribal prints introduce cultural richness and can serve as focal points. Try to mix at least one bold pattern with two or more subtle patterns to maintain balance in your bedding ensemble.
